Analyzing and Displaying Test Data
Creating Expressions with the Formula Object
Creating Expressions with the Formula
Object
The Formula object can be used to write mathematical expressions in VEE.
The variables in the expression are the data input pin names or global
variables. The result of the evaluation of the expression will be put on the
data output pin.
Figure 4-5 shows a
Formula object. The input field for the expression is in
the center of the object. A default expression
(2*A+3) indicates where to
enter the formula. Just double-click the field to type in a different
expression.
Note You can type in a Formula expression on more than one line. If a Formula
expression contains a Return, it is interpreted as a multi-line single
expression. If a
Formula contains statements separated by semi-colons (;),
they are interpreted as multiple expressions in the Formula.
You can also use standard editing commands to edit expressions in a
Formula. For example, you can drag the mouse to highlight characters, use
Ctrl-C for copying the characters, Ctrl-V for pasting, and Ctrl-X for deleting.
